What is a Nespresso Machine?
A Nespresso machine is a specialized coffee machine created to brew espresso and coffee from user friendly coffee capsules, likewise referred to as pods. At first introduced in 1986 by Nestlé, Nespresso has become an international phenomenon, boasting a comprehensive line of coffee machines engineered for every single coffee fan's requirements.

Benefits of Owning a Nespresso Machine
- Convenience: With the easy insertion of a coffee pod and a press of a button, you can delight in high-quality coffee in under a minute.
- Consistency: Each coffee capsule is pre-measured for optimal brewing, guaranteeing your coffee tastes the exact same each time.
- Variety: Nespresso offers a vast choice of coffee blends and flavors, accommodating different taste preferences.
- Minimal Cleanup: Most Nespresso machines instantly eject pills after developing, and lots of parts are dishwasher safe.
- Compact Design: Many Nespresso models feature a smooth and space-efficient style, enabling them to fit comfortably on kitchen counters.

Upkeep Tips for Nespresso Machines
To guarantee your Nespresso machine operates optimally and has a longer lifespan, it's essential to carry out regular maintenance.
- Regular Cleaning: Clean the water tank, pills container, and drip tray often. Most drip trays and water tanks are dishwashing machine safe.
- Descaling: Regular descaling helps eliminate mineral accumulation, particularly if you utilize hard water. Nespresso advises descaling every 3 months.
- Water Quality: Use filtered or bottled water to keep the machine's performance and enhance the flavor of your coffee.
- Storage of Capsules: Store pills in a cool, dry location to maintain their freshness. Prevent direct sunshine and high humidity.
- Inspect for Updates: Some newer models feature software updates, so inspect the Nespresso website for maintenance ideas and upgrades.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How does a Nespresso machine work?
Nespresso machines use a high-pressure developing system to extract coffee from pills. The machine pierces the capsule, forcing hot water through it and extracting the flavors and aromas.
2. Can I use my coffee grounds with a Nespresso machine?
Most Nespresso machines are created specifically for their exclusive pills. Nevertheless, some models, like the Nespresso U, support recyclable coffee pod accessories that allow you to utilize your own grounds.
3. Are Nespresso pills recyclable?
Yes, Nespresso offers a recycling program for its aluminum pills. You can return used capsules to designated collection points or order a recycling bag through their website.
4. Can I make milk-based beverages with a Nespresso machine?
Numerous Nespresso machines featured milk frothers or steam wands to create lattes, cappuccinos, and other milk-based drinks. Additionally, you can purchase a different milk frother.
